BBQ tradition turns 20

Olin’s 20th Annual Welcome Back BBQ served more than 1,000 hungry students, professors, and staff on Aug. 25, 2014.

For the first time in its history, the cookout was held in the Knight Center Courtyard. The 95-plus degree heat drove many guests inside to tables in the new Atrium and the Knight Center Dining Room. An ice sculpture melted quickly as Dean Mahendra Gupta, faculty and staff dished out 730 hamburger and veggie burgers, and 300 hotdogs. Baked beans, salad, cake, and lots of lemonade completed the perfect menu for the first day of classes.
